On a MIPS Malta board, tons of fifo underflow errors have been observed when using u-boot as bootloader instead of YAMON. The reason for that is that YAMON used to set the pcnet device to SRAM mode but u-boot does not. As a result, the default Tx threshold (64 bytes) is now too small to keep the fifo relatively used and it can result to Tx fifo underflow errors.
